Using Custom Strongly Typed Values For Better Coding in Swift

A picture of three links of an iron chain.
Photo by Edge2Edge Media on Unsplash

Not so long ago I discussed in this post about how to define enums with custom raw types in Swift. Creating enums with cases that can be either of a primitive data type, or a custom one as presented in that previous post, helps achieving a simple, yet quite…



An iOS & macOS app maker writing code in Swift. Author of countless programming tutorials. Content creator.

Love podcasts or audiobooks? Learn on the go with our new app.

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store